I`ve been using the PC on a few cars already polishing with the 1z paint polish (the green can), and the conditions of the paints i`ve used it on were fairly swirled and damaged.



I tried to get oxidation spot out, roughly a 3inch area, and i ended up burning some of the paint off!:eek:



running through the car a couple of times with the PC i felt that 1z wasant cutting it for me, and one reason being that oxidated area. it did a good job and took out some of the major swirlage but swirls were still there! also the paint didnt feel as clean as i thought it shouldve been.



whats a good polish to go onto next? I was thinking DACP, but does it have the same or better cutting ability as 1z paint polish(green can)?

If the paint feels rough to you, you should probably try claying first. After that, you can try the DACP. I`ve only used 3M and Menzerna products, so I don`t know how they compare to DACP or 1Z. I did see a polish comparison chart over at Properautocare.com showing that DACP was equivalent to 3M`s Fine Cut Rubbing Compound and Menzerna Intensive Polish. If you`re looking to buy some new polish and you`re only using PC, I would suggest you get Menzerna`s Intensive Polish and Final Polish II. They are both superior products.
